About This Book
Here’s a little secret: some tiny words like I, me, and it have a big job—they stand in for people and things! These special words are called pronouns, and they can be singular or plural. But that’s only the beginning...

Quick Assessment
This early reader introduces children ages 5-8 to pronouns, explaining their use in simple, clear language with helpful examples and humorous illustrations. It supports foundational grammar skills as part of the Language Rules series, making it suitable for young learners beginning to explore parts of speech. The content is straightforward and age-appropriate for early elementary readers.
